8 injured in the 2-vehicle accident on Friday on the I-90; 1 clever in the Elgin Hospital

Around midnight, the authorities said on Friday that there was a two-vehicle accident west on the Interstate 90 west of the Harmony Road in Mchenry County.

The crash near Milepost 39 meant that seven people were treated and released at the scene. According to Hampshire Fire Protection District and Illinois State Police, a person was taken to a hospital in Elgin.

Preliminary reports show that the crash included a white Infiniti QX56 and a black Toyota Camry, which both traveled west on the left lane. The infinity hit the back of the Camry. The infinity went out of control and, according to the police, rolled onto his roof, which blocked the left lane.

A passenger in the Infiniti was brought to a regional hospital with injuries, said the ISP -Trooper Jason Wilson.

“The two left streets were closed for a short time for the examination and removal of both units,” said Wilson.

The location was released at 1 a.m. The crash is being examined, the police said.
